Postdoctoral position available in an ERC-funded project exploring
deep-learning implementations of the Global Workspace theory.
We are seeking a highly motivated and dedicated post-doc to join our
group in Toulouse, France in the Fall/Winter of 2026. The successful
candidate will have a PhD and formal training in AI, Computer Science or
related fields (e.g. computational neuroscience), and a keen interest in
cognitive neuroscience. Our ERC Advanced Grant "GLoW" (2023-2028) aims
to take inspiration from neuroscience and cognitive theories to build
deep neural network models of cognition, capable of integrating or
"grounding" information across sensory and linguistic modalities, and of
displaying flexible cognitive behavior. Details on the ideas developed
in the project can be found in this Opinion paper
<https://www.cell.com/trends/neurosciences/fulltext/S0166-2236(21)00077-1>.
The project is headed by Rufin VanRullen (CNRS, Toulouse, France), with
external advisors Ryota Kanai (Araya, Tokyo, Japan) and Murray Shanahan
(ICL/Deepmind, London, UK).
Our lab <https://rufinv.github.io/> is part of the CerCo Institute
<https://cerco.cnrs.fr/en> as well as the Artificial and Natural
Intelligence Toulouse Institute (ANITI)
<https://aniti.univ-toulouse.fr/en/>. Our team has many opportunities to
collaborate with neuroscientists, computer scientists, linguists,
roboticists etc. We have access to in-house (GPU) computing clusters as
well as research-dedicated supercomputers.
Typical appointments for post-docs are for 1 year, renewable for a 2nd
year and beyond. The beginning post-doc salary is about 2,500
Euros/month (net), and can reach 3,500 Euros/month (net) for more
